Trump's stance on Iraq unacceptable: Ammar Hakim

Leader of the National Wisdom Movement of Iraq Ammar al-Hakim called the words of US President Donald Trump on Iraq as unacceptable stressing that it is natural that the political groups and the Iraqi government to take position against it.

In Sulaymaniyah Political Conference, which was attended by some Iraqi political leaders and foreign diplomats and foreign guests, Sayyed Ammar al-Hakim said that the remarks of a country's president who says that he would withdraw his military forces from Syria and send them to Iraq or through Iraqi territory will monitor, an Iraqi neighboring country, are unacceptable.

Pointing out that Ein al-Assad's military base on the Iraqi soil belongs to the Iraqi government, he said that such a president (Trump) says he would have made billions to build this military base in Iraq is against the spirit of the constitution and the bilateral agreement signed between the two countries.

He implicitly referred to Trump's positions at a recent juncture towards Iraq with media motives and for domestic consumption, and emphasized that it would be natural for all political groups and the Iraqi government to take a negative stance against such statements.
